Luke 22:55, 56, 57, 58, 59, 60, 61, 62, 63, 64, 65

Luke 22:55 NIV

And when some there had kindled a fire in the middle of the courtyard and had sat down together, Peter sat down with them.

Luke 22:56 NIV

A servant girl saw him seated there in the firelight. She looked closely at him and said, “This man was with him.”

Luke 22:57 NIV

But he denied it. “Woman, I don’t know him,” he said.

Luke 22:58 NIV

A little later someone else saw him and said, “You also are one of them.” “Man, I am not!” Peter replied.

Luke 22:59 NIV

About an hour later another asserted, “Certainly this fellow was with him, for he is a Galilean.”

Luke 22:60 NIV

Peter replied, “Man, I don’t know what you’re talking about!” Just as he was speaking, the rooster crowed.

Luke 22:61 NIV

The Lord turned and looked straight at Peter. Then Peter remembered the word the Lord had spoken to him: “Before the rooster crows today, you will disown me three times.”

Luke 22:62 NIV

And he went outside and wept bitterly.

Luke 22:63 NIV

The men who were guarding Jesus began mocking and beating him.

Luke 22:64 NIV

They blindfolded him and demanded, “Prophesy! Who hit you?”

Luke 22:65 NIV

And they said many other insulting things to him.
